I do hate changes, but when my sister Laura, who keeps house for me, determined to movefurther uptown, I really had no choice in the matter but to acquiesce. I am a bachelor oflong standing, and it's my opinion that the way to manage women is simply to humor theirwhims, and since Laura's husband died I've been rather more indulgent to her than before. Any way, the chief thing to have in one's household is peace, and I found I secured thateasily enough by letting Laura do just as she liked; and as in return she kept my homecomfortable and pleasant for me, I considered that honors were even. Therefore, when shedecided we would move, I made no serious objection. At least, not in advance. Had I known what apartment-hunting meant I should have refusedto leave our Gramercy Park home. But "Uptown" and "West Side" represented to Laura the Mecca of her desires, and Iunsuspectingly agreed to her plans.
